Output efac96863d64dfa112945605966f3b82eac4d004687299c746722e4961e6002a:0

value
3644375
script pubkey
OP_0 OP_PUSHBYTES_20 184e44b584c34ba941ac987f1cf32e289694068e
address
ltc1qrp8yfdvycd96jsdvnpl3euew9ztfgp5w7s85hf
transaction
efac96863d64dfa112945605966f3b82eac4d004687299c746722e4961e6002a
spent
true